Materials that shed water and allow good drainage tend to perform best in freeze-thaw conditions; well-compacted base layers and permeable surfacing reduce frost heave. Avoid fine, uncompacted fills in areas prone to standing water, and plan for proper subgrade prep and drainage. Regional suppliers can suggest blends suited to West Idaho weather patterns.
Measure the length, width, and desired depth in feet, multiply to get cubic feet, and divide by 27 to convert to cubic yards; for tons, use our online calculator since weight varies by material. Allow extra for compaction and waste (commonly 5-10%). Use Hello Gravel's calculator or contact our team to confirm quantities for your specific material and project.
Late spring through early fall is generally best to avoid freeze-thaw issues and heavy rains, which can delay installations and affect compaction. If you must work in wet seasons, plan for drainage control and flexible scheduling. Always check local weather and book deliveries in advance, especially for peak seasons.

Delivery cost and truck choice depend on driveway width, overhead clearance, road weight limits, and distance from the supplier. If access is tight, smaller trucks or offload options may be needed and can add fees. Upload photos and clear notes at checkout so we can match the right equipment and provide accurate pricing.

Good results start with a stable subgrade, proper slope away from structures, and a designed drainage path to avoid standing water. Use geotextile fabric where needed, compact base layers, and select surface materials that match your drainage goals. If you have poor soils or standing water, consult a local contractor or our team for options that reduce frost heave and erosion.
